All information reffered to in the diagram to the right is taken from Approved Document M Volume 2 unless otherwise stated (HM Government, 2020).

The importance of making this building as accessible as possible is paramount. The building is based sround the concept of providing resources to people on the western edge of the city centre who dont have the resources the yneed readily available to them. This becomes even more pertinent whe nconsidering if the existing reources in the city centre are accessible to e.g. wheelchair users.

Disabled car parking is provided down the side of the extension to the building (in compliance with the dimensions outlined in diagram 2). These are also level with the entrance to the building and interior floor level

This toilet has been designed for wheelchair users and people with other disabilities. It meets the requirements outlined in diagrams 18 and 19.

The old, disused lift shaft has been converted into a dry riser. This carries pipework from the water tank to feed the sprinkler system throughout the building.

The new lift shaft also functions as a dry riser.

The ecape routes are not sufficiently protected and there would need to be a significant level of protection added to the large open spaces they pass through

These doors are not sufficiently wide to accomodate wheelchair users - a more appropriate width would be 800mm as opposed to 750mm

The doors to the fire safe core are outward opening, self closing (as outlined in diagram 2.4) and have a glass panel to see into a space on exit to see if it is safe.

Dr Dr

The main fire core has a lift that has dual openings allowing for easy access to all floors of the building from either side of the lift. This lift meets the minimum dimensions as outlined in diagram 11.

The main entrance doors of the building are power assisted and have a level transistion from the exterior paving to the internal floor. The eliminates the need for ramps etc.

The large, double-height glazed sections of the facade will be fitted with visibility dots so as to improve the visibiliy of the glass to people who are visually impaired.
